ALEXANDRIA, Va., March 19 -- United States Patent no. 12,253,961, issued on March 18, was assigned to ADVANCED MICRO DEVICES INC. (Santa Clara, Calif.).

"Staging memory access requests" was invented by James R. Magro (Austin, Texas), Kedarnath Balakrishnan (Bangalore, India), Ravindra N. Bhargava (Austin, Texas) and Guanhao Shen (Austin, Texas).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"Staging memory access requests includes receiving a memory access request directed to Dynamic Random Access Memory; storing the memory access request in a staging buffer; and moving the memory access request from the staging buffer to a command queue."
